Raven is depicted in many Northwest Coast Native art prints: White Raven, Sharing Knowledge, Five Ravens, Tree of Life and more. The Raven Symbol. Raven is one of the most important creatures in Northwest Coast mythology and art. He is a powerful, cultural focus and symbol.

The Raven is one of the most beloved birds in Native American mythology. It has been a prominent figure in the oral traditions of many Indigenous peoples throughout history, and its tales have played an essential role in shaping traditional beliefs and rituals.

The Raven's Mythological Origins. In Native American mythology, ravens are often attributed with the creation of the world. According to the Haida tribe of the Pacific Northwest, the Raven was a shape-shifter who brought light and life to a world shrouded in darkness. This powerful myth has made the raven a symbol of creation and enlightenment.
